WebMar 24, 2024 · 71% isopropyl alcohol, 99% isopropyl alcohol, and rubbing alcohol are all effective at cleaning gel polish from your brushes. Rubbing alcohol is essentially a mixture of isopropyl and ethyl alcohol diluted with water. Alcohol is the better option to clean nail art brushes without damaging them.

WebJan 11, 2024 · Rubbing alcohol is used to thoroughly clean your nails before you apply gel polish because it removes anything that could get in the way of the polish binding to your natural nail. WebMar 23, 2024 · Rubbing alcohol helps with setting your nail bed with a clean and unblemished surface so that the gel polish can adhere to your nails as effectively as possible. This is especially important if you had used cuticle oil previously because the rubbing alcohol frees the surface of your nail bed of oil traces.
